The OLAES Modular Trauma Dressing is a highly versatile solution for advanced wound care and bleeding control. Trusted by military personnel, first responders, and healthcare professionals, it combines simplicity with multifunctionality — ideal for addressing complex trauma scenarios in high-pressure situations.

Each dressing includes a large trauma pad, 3 metres of sterile 4-ply packing gauze, a plastic occlusive sheet for burns or chest injuries, and a transparent pressure cup that focuses pressure on the wound. It’s a must-have for tactical or civilian emergency kits.

Features

  • Latex-Free: Safe for use on all patients, including those with latex allergies.
  • Built-in Control Strips: Elastic wrap includes control strips to prevent unravelling during application.
  • Packing Gauze: Contains 3 metres of sterile 4-ply gauze for deep wound packing.
  • Occlusive Sheet: Included for sealing small burns or chest injuries.
  • Transparent Pressure Cup: Focuses pressure directly on the wound and allows visual inspection (also doubles as an eye cup).
  • Heavy-Duty Elastic Bandage: Ensures reliable coverage under stress.
  • Modular Design: Features velcro “brakes” for controlled and easy application.

Specifications

  • Size Options: Available in 4", 6", and 4" flat-packed versions.
  • Use Case: Suitable for wound packing, compression, and chest trauma care in field and clinical settings.

FAQs

What is the OLAES Modular Trauma Dressing used for?

It's designed for advanced wound care, bleeding control, and trauma treatment — including burns, GSWs, and chest injuries.

How does the pressure cup work?

The pressure cup focuses compression on the wound site and allows visual confirmation of bleeding. It can also serve as an eye shield in emergencies.

Is the OLAES Dressing suitable for military use?

Yes, it’s widely used by military medics and tactical responders for its ruggedness and modular versatility in the field.

Can it be used in civilian emergencies?

Absolutely — it’s ideal for high-stakes civilian scenarios such as road trauma, workplace accidents, and remote medical care.

What makes it “modular”?

The inclusion of multiple components — trauma pad, gauze, occlusive sheet, and pressure cup — allows it to adapt to a variety of injuries.

Is the OLAES Dressing reusable?

No, it is vacuum-sealed and designed for single-use only to ensure sterility and effectiveness.

Is it suitable for self-application?

Yes, the design allows for rapid one-handed application, even under stress.
